Understanding Power Steering Fluid Leaks: The Problem
Power steering fluid leaks occur when the hydraulic fluid escapes from the sealed system designed to assist your steering. This loss of fluid directly impacts the system's ability to function, leading to increased steering effort, noise, and potentially complete steering failure. When your power steering system develops a leak, the first signs are often subtle but critical. You might notice a darker, slicker patch on your driveway or a low fluid level warning light on your dashboard. Beyond these visual cues, the steering wheel itself becomes a primary indicator. It may feel heavier, especially at low speeds, or you might hear whining or groaning noises emanating from the pump as it struggles to operate with insufficient fluid.

Root Causes and Specific Leak Points
What precisely causes these leaks? The power steering system is a complex network of hoses, seals, pumps, and steering gears. Any compromise in these components can lead to fluid escaping. Common culprits include worn-out seals within the power steering pump, the steering rack, or hydraulic hoses themselves. Over time, rubber components degrade, becoming brittle and prone to cracking or splitting. High operating pressures and heat exacerbate this wear.
External factors can also contribute significantly. Road debris or impacts can damage hoses or the steering rack housing. Improper installation during previous repairs, such as overtightening or cross-threading power steering fittings, can stress components and lead to premature failure. Even minor vibrations over thousands of miles can loosen connections or wear down seals.
The integrity of the entire steering system hinges on the sealed nature of its hydraulic circuit.
Specific components are frequent leak points. The high-pressure hose carrying fluid from the pump to the steering rack, or the return hose back to the reservoir, can develop cracks or loose fittings. The seals inside the power steering pump are also a common source, often indicated by leaks near the pump pulley. Similarly, seals within the steering rack and pinion unit, particularly at the bellows joints, are prone to degradation, allowing fluid and road grime to enter the system, causing further damage. Effective Solutions and Preventative Maintenance
Addressing power steering fluid leaks requires a systematic approach. First, accurately pinpoint the source of the leak. This often involves cleaning the entire system thoroughly, then running the engine briefly and observing where fluid reappears. Once identified, the repair strategy depends on the faulty component. Minor leaks from hose connections might be resolved by tightening or replacing a fitting. More substantial leaks from a hose necessitate replacing the entire hose. Always use the exact type of power steering fluid recommended by your vehicle manufacturer; using the wrong fluid can damage seals and cause further leaks.
Prevention is key to avoiding future headaches. Regular inspections of your power steering system, including hoses and fittings, during routine maintenance can catch minor issues before they become major leaks. Maintaining the correct fluid level and checking for any signs of wear or damage are simple yet effective practices.
